Family tree Weening » Hendrik Harm Hein (1893-1987)

Personal data Hendrik Harm Hein 


Household of Hendrik Harm Hein

He is married to Tietje Boersma.

They got married on February 12, 1930 at Ulrum (Gr), he was 36 years old.Source 3
